Overview

Surf At Surf School in Colares offers safe, skill-focused surfing classes for kids aged 6–12. Perfectly positioned on Portugal’s dynamic Lisboa coast, their lessons combine hands-on experience with safety and fun.

Details

Colares, a coastal village in the Lisboa region of Portugal, offers a rugged Atlantic shoreline that pulses with energy and opportunity. Here, Surf At Surf School delivers engaging surfing classes designed specifically for children aged 6 to 12, turning the wild waves of this stretch of coast into a safe and thrilling playground. Known for its consistent swell and sandy beaches framed by dramatic cliffs and pine-covered slopes, Colares provides an ideal setting for young learners to build confidence in the water.

Surf At Surf School’s children’s lessons emphasize a grounded approach to surfing fundamentals: balancing technique with safety and practical water skills. Coaches bring a patient, hands-on methodology where kids develop discipline and resilience by learning to read the ocean’s rhythm. The school supplies all necessary equipment—child-sized boards, wetsuits, and safety gear—so parents and kids alike can focus on the joy and challenge of wave riding without distraction.

Adventure Tips

Arrive Early for Calm Conditions

Morning sessions often feature gentler waves, ideal for children new to surfing.

Bring a Waterproof Sunscreen

Protecting young skin against strong Atlantic sun is essential during lessons.

Listen Carefully to Instructors

Kids should follow safety instructions closely to ensure a secure surfing experience.

Wear Suitable Wetsuits

Wetsuits help keep kids warm in varying water temperatures year-round.
